Andy Bishop
Local Vermont vibes! If your looking delicious food served by friendly staff the Rustic Rooster is the place for you. Be careful this hidden gem is off VT Route 103 southbound side, while the gps notes the resteraunt is in Shrewsbury, VT (Cuttingsville is closer). Blink and you may miss it. Offering daily and a full menu, the Rustic Rooster has plenty to choose from. I decided on picking a cup of the potato and bacon soup appetizer and Asian wrap from the specials menu. Both were very good. On tap, the Rustic Rooster had a decent beer selection. The seasonal draft was a stout, I’m not a fan so I chose the Catamount IPA which was ok. It definitely does not match up with Fiddleheads IPA which was also available! The Rustic Rooster is worth a visit when traveling in central Vermont.
